With urban spaces becoming more crowded, people are turning to their own balconies to grow fresh, healthy produce.</p><p>Planting vegetables on your balcony has many benefits, both for the environment and for you. It is a sustainable way of living, reducing the need for transportation and packaging involved in purchasing vegetables from the grocery store. Growing your own food also ensures that you know exactly what goes into it, without having to worry about synthetic fertilizers or pesticides.</p><p>In addition to being environmentally friendly, planting vegetables on your balcony can also be a therapeutic activity. It allows you to connect with nature, providing a calming escape from the stresses of modern life. Tending to your plants can also be a form of mindfulness, helping you to focus on the present moment and find peace in the midst of chaos.</p><p>When it comes to the actual process of planting vegetables on your balcony, there are a few key things to keep in mind. First and foremost, you'll need to consider the space you have available. Depending on the size of your balcony, you may need to choose between different types of plants or use creative solutions to maximize your space.</p><p>Another factor to consider is sunlight. Different plants require different levels of sunlight, so it's important to choose plants that are appropriate for your balcony's exposure. If your balcony gets a lot of direct sunlight, you may need to use shade cloth to protect your plants during the hottest hours of the day.</p><p>One popular option for balcony gardening is vertical planting. This involves using hanging pots or trellises to grow plants vertically, rather than horizontally. This can be a great way to save space while still enjoying a variety of fresh vegetables and herbs.</p><p>Overall, planting vegetables on your balcony is a rewarding and fulfilling way to connect with nature and enjoy the benefits of fresh, healthy produce. With a little planning and creativity, anyone can transform their balcony into a thriving garden.</p>
